Meeting notes (excerpt) — dispatch desk briefing, Tellan Instruments. Agenda item 3: returned demo units. Six demo spectrometers came back from the Quorrin trade fair; two show cosmetic damage, flagged for inspection before restocking. All six are palletised in bay 4 and booked with Larkfell Transit for Thursday. Paperwork is complete except the driver acknowledgment slip, which the desk must collect on site. When the Larkfell driver arrives, apply the confidential hand-over instruction given below.

dispatch memo: the quenvan holax courier leaves the zoreth briath kasvan ledger at gate 7481 under passcode 618862

**Changelog — Key Rotation, Vexfield Partner SFTP Drop**

Rotated the deploy key used by the nightly Vexfield partner SFTP drop after the quarterly audit flagged it as past its 90-day window. The old key was revoked at cutover, and the transfer job was re-run successfully against the staging endpoint. No files were delayed. The new public key, already shared with Vexfield's integration team, is below.

deploy key for kajof-fajop: bky6_gDHw9Q

Plugin authors integrating with the Restockly planner must use a dedicated service account rather than personal credentials. Each account is scoped to route forecasting and slot inventory only; machine telemetry requires a separate grant. Rotate quarterly. For sandbox development against the planner's internal scheduling service, use the shared test key below.

gateway credential: kto23_LX9A4ys6i4nzHtpOLNLodKK